    I have an RSVP event that is three days long. The user can select and pay for one of the three days or the ‘complete package’ which is all three. The issue that I’m having is no matter what day the user selects and pays for the conformation email subject line always lists the first day of the event even if the selected the the third day. How can I make the subject line date reflect the day the user chose?

    Also if the user registers but doesn’t proceed with the Paypal payment is there any type of automatic reminder email or a payment link to forward?

    The best I can do with the current code is allow you to remove the date from the headline entirely. You should be able to have the day selection detail reflected in the body of the message. Go to RSVP Email -> Notification Templates and remove the [rsvpdate] from the Confirmation Message subject line.

    This will be a global change, not just for that one event.

    Currently, there’s no automated nag for a registration where the person didn’t complete the payment. I could add it for a fee, but otherwise it goes on the todo list for someday.
